What makes this a great opportunity?

Reporting to the Head of Global RTD Supply Chain and Contract Manufacturing this role will lead all aspects of business in relation to Contract Manufacturing to deliver world-class results in cost, quality, and customer service.

The main focus of this role will be developing and maintaining long-term business relationships with contract manufacturing partners to exceed company objectives including volume growth, product quality, service, and cost optimization. This role will provide a consistent approach to identifying, selecting, qualifying, and managing contract manufacturing partners.


This role will work cross-functionally and provide clear communication of priorities by leading efforts between Brand/Marketing, Procurement, Quality, Research and Development, Transportation & Warehousing, Finance, and Sales &Operations Planning.  This role is also responsible for managing the relationships where Beam Suntory contract manufactures for other companies. This could include relationships where Beam Suntory acquires, divests, or partners with other companies.

Role Responsibilities

Key Responsibilities

  • Owns and leads the E2E Supply Chain network of Co-Manufacturing short-term and long-term strategic design, implementation and optimization for the region.
  • Orchestrate the different Supply Chain functions related to the selection and operation of Co-Manufacturing partners, such as Legal, Planning, Procurement, Quality, Fulfillment, Finance amongst other.
  • As responsible of the relationship management with the Co-Manufacturing partners, manage all activities between Beam Suntory internal teams and contract manufacturing partners to facilitate innovation, performance, and productivity projects.
  • Own and lead co-man/co-pack contracting efforts, integrating viewpoints from stakeholders and subject matter experts, proposing co-investment / investment opportunities (e.g., pilot line) to meet business objectives.
  • Responsible for quality, case fill, dry good and finished goods inventory, finished goods production, cost controls, project management, reporting, regulatory compliance, sustainability, and the overall relationship with our Contract Manufacturing partners.
  • Partner and collaborate with Global RTD for regional initiatives related to RTD (Spirits based and Flavored Malt Beverage-FMB). Similarly, support potential partnerships with other entities such as Suntory Beverage & Food (SBF).
  • Performs as Supply Chain and Co-Manufacturing representative in key regional forums such as StageGate, Supply Reviews, Monthly Reviews amongst other. 
  • Collaborate with Supply Planning to provide regular capacity analysis based on demonstrated performance to ensure adequate capacity is available to meet demand.
  • Establish and report KPIs for Contract Manufacturers in quality, food safety, customer service, and cost.
  • Support and contribute the development of global Co-Manufacturing framework and global standard procedures.
  • Conduct regular operational reviews to identify opportunity areas and eliminate waste.
  • Manage inventory discrepancies, claims for excess losses, or supplier non-conformance to control costs and ensure quick resolution of outstanding issues.
  • Develop a risk management plan for supplemental production options to mitigate service issues in the event of internal/external manufacturing disruptions.
  • Update Contract Manufacturing and cross-functional leadership on emerging manufacturing opportunities and risks. Develop effective and timely contingency plans to avoid issues.
  • Independently manage complex projects ensuring critical success criteria are met.
  • Coach internal teams on contract manufacturer relations to improve execution.
  • Develop policies, processes, and procedures to ensure compliance with our contracts.
  • Conduct searches and establish a network of potential partners for future innovation and growth.
  • Manage business, relationship, and projects where Beam Suntory contract manufactures for other companies.
  • Network with other companies to bring new contract manufacturing opportunities to Beam Suntory.
  • Collaborate with Corporate Strategy team on divestures, acquisitions, and partnerships as required.
